End of life care services have been disrupted during the pandemic, and services have adapted significantly in response. As noted above, there has been a significant shift in the proportion of people dying at home, with a third more people dying at home than pre-pandemic.

WebRegular activity can help you manage heart failure. You may not be able to have the same level of intensity as in the past. Regular aerobic training can help increase your physical abilities and quality of life. Aim for at least 30 minutes per day on most days of the week. Begin slowly and work your way to this goal. WebPalliative care is treatment, care and support for people living with a life-limiting illness. A life-limiting illness is an illness that can’t be cured and that you’re likely to die from. Life-limiting illnesses can include: cancer. motor neurone disease. end-stage kidney disease. dementia. Palliative care also supports your family and ...

Portable infusion pumps are used in palliative care to deliver a continuous subcutaneous infusion of medication over 24 hours. Mixing of medications in this manner is unlicensed but is supported by practice.
